1860
Rev George Washington McGirt was born in Jul 1860 in Camden,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A a child of Cyrus McGirt and Rachel Young McGirt.
1870
Washington McGirt was counted in the census on 07 Jun 1870 in De Kalb,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A, as a 10-year-old, male, black. Also in the home were; Cyrus McGirt, Rachel McGirt, Israel McGirt, Eli McGirt, Rose McGirt, Laura McGirt, Frank McGirt, Margaret McGirt, and Rachel McGirt.
1890
When he was 29, he married Minnie Brevard about 1890.
1900
Georjeld Mcgir? was counted in the census in Jun 1900 in Camden,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A, as a 40-year-old, male, married, black. Also in the home were; his wife, Minnie Mcgir?; and his children, Edilliam Mcgir?, Edward Mcgir?, Rachel Mcgir?, and George Mcgir?.
1910
George W Mcgirt was counted in the census on 21 Apr 1910 in Camden,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A, as a 49-year-old, male, married, black, head of household. Also in the home were; his wife, Minnie Mcgirt; and his children, William C Mcgirt, Edward J Mcgirt, Rachael R Mcgirt, George L Mcgirt, Paul B Mcgirt, Theodore R Mcgirt, and Ralph Mcgirt.
1920
George W McGirt was counted in the census on 30 Jan 1920 in Camden,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A, as a 53-year-old, male, married, black, head of household. Also in the home were; his wife, Minnie McGirt; and his children, Willie McGirt, Rachael McGirt, Leslie McGirt, Paul McGirt, Ralph McGirt, Beatrice McGirt, and Laura McGirt.
1933
On April 2, 1933, George W. McGirt was mentioned as the father in the death record of Eddie C. McGirt.
1940
Wash McGirt was counted in the census on 23 Apr 1940 in De Kalb,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A, as a 79-year-old, male, married, black, head of household. Also in the home were; his wife, Minnie McGirt; and his son, George Lesley McGirt.
1941
He died on 06 Mar 1941 in Camden,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A. He was buried on 06 Mar 1941 in Camden, Kershaw, South Carolina, USA at Cedars Cemetery. His cause of death was general angina pectoris and deficit.
